#67094a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#67094a is composed of 40.4% red, 3.5%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.3% magenta, 28.2%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 318.5 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 22%. #67094a color hex could be obtained by blending #ce1294 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#67094a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0109 is the darkest color, while #fffaf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#67094a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c343a is the less saturated color, while #70004d is the most saturated one.
